> From: Brett Creeley <brett.creeley@intel.com>
>
> Currently in i40e_vc_disable_queues_msg() we are incorrectly validating the
> virtchnl queue select bitmaps. The virtchnl_queue_select rx_queues and
> tx_queue bitmap is being compared against ICE_MAX_VF_QUEUES, but the
> problem is that these bitmaps can have a value greater than
> I40E_MAX_VF_QUEUES.
> Fix this by comparing the bitmaps against BIT(I40E_MAX_VF_QUEUES).
>
> Also, add the function i40e_vc_validate_vqs_bitmaps() that checks to see if
> both virtchnl_queue_select bitmaps are empty along with checking that the
> bitmaps only have valid bits set. This function can then be used in both the
> queue enable and disable flows.
